Output 62e7d87c780984a753036a3f1b0f534a5bd2501432c56ff7e4ef920ee3c98161:1

value
1159708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6252858cbfd8ac83fb3d9a193a72ac442a102a4f OP_EQUAL
address
3Aeu13r8ePXfwnjK1PPXyk9iN9t81JMv9M
transaction
62e7d87c780984a753036a3f1b0f534a5bd2501432c56ff7e4ef920ee3c98161
spent
true